Don't waste that heat! Industrial processes often generate large amounts of waste heat, which, if effectively captured and reused - such as for preheating incoming materials, space heating, or driving other processes - can significantly lower the demand for additional energy input. 


In this webinar, our experts explain how investing in efficient heat exchangers, condensate return systems and waste heat recovery units enables manufacturers to convert what was once lost energy into a valuable resource, boosting both environmental performance and operational efficiency.
